 | #ifdef CONFIG_PPC_OF_PLATFORM_PCI | 
 |  | 
 | /* The probing of PCI controllers from of_platform is currently | 
 |  * 64 bits only, mostly due to gratuitous differences between | 
 |  * the 32 and 64 bits PCI code on PowerPC and the 32 bits one | 
 |  * lacking some bits needed here. | 
 |  */ | 
 |  | 
 | static int __devinit of_pci_phb_probe(struct platform_device *dev) | 
 | { | 
 | 	struct pci_controller *phb; | 
 |  | 
 | 	/* Check if we can do that ... */ | 
 | 	if (ppc_md.pci_setup_phb == NULL) | 
 | 		return -ENODEV; | 
 |  | 
 | 	pr_info("Setting up PCI bus %s\n", dev->dev.of_node->full_name); | 
 |  | 
 | 	/* Alloc and setup PHB data structure */ | 
 | 	phb = pcibios_alloc_controller(dev->dev.of_node); | 
 | 	if (!phb) | 
 | 		return -ENODEV; | 
 |  | 
 | 	/* Setup parent in sysfs */ | 
 | 	phb->parent = &dev->dev; | 
 |  | 
 | 	/* Setup the PHB using arch provided callback */ | 
 | 	if (ppc_md.pci_setup_phb(phb)) { | 
 | 		pcibios_free_controller(phb); | 
 | 		return -ENODEV; | 
 | 	} | 
 |  | 
 | 	/* Process "ranges" property */ | 
 | 	pci_process_bridge_OF_ranges(phb, dev->dev.of_node, 0); | 
 |  | 
 | 	/* Init pci_dn data structures */ | 
 | 	pci_devs_phb_init_dynamic(phb); | 
 |  | 
 | 	/* Create EEH devices for the PHB */ | 
 | 	eeh_dev_phb_init_dynamic(phb); | 
 |  | 
 | 	/* Register devices with EEH */ | 
 | #ifdef CONFIG_EEH | 
 | 	if (dev->dev.of_node->child) | 
 | 		eeh_add_device_tree_early(dev->dev.of_node); | 
 | #endif /* CONFIG_EEH */ | 
 |  | 
 | 	/* Scan the bus */ | 
 | 	pcibios_scan_phb(phb); | 
 | 	if (phb->bus == NULL) | 
 | 		return -ENXIO; | 
 |  | 
 | 	/* Claim resources. This might need some rework as well depending | 
 | 	 * wether we are doing probe-only or not, like assigning unassigned | 
 | 	 * resources etc... | 
 | 	 */ | 
 | 	pcibios_claim_one_bus(phb->bus); | 
 |  | 
 | 	/* Finish EEH setup */ | 
 | #ifdef CONFIG_EEH | 
 | 	eeh_add_device_tree_late(phb->bus); | 
 | #endif | 
 |  | 
 | 	/* Add probed PCI devices to the device model */ | 
 | 	pci_bus_add_devices(phb->bus); | 
 |  | 
 | 	return 0; | 
 | } |
